## Ownership

Quick heads-up for the sync: this repo holds the health-check probes that sit behind the Foglamp load balancer for the Quillstone services. If a node starts flapping, the probes here decide whether it gets drained, so changes are not low-stakes — please don't merge without a review. Runbooks live in the docs folder, and the on-call rotation covers weekends. For anything ambiguous, ping the service owner directly rather than guessing; that person's full name is right below.

named custodian: Brivan Eliath Quenox Frador

Release checklist — Wayfarer app deep links. Verify that links for profiles, orders, and gift pages route correctly on both cold and warm starts, and that unknown paths fall back to the home screen rather than a blank view. Test on at least one legacy OS version. Mark this item complete only after pasting the routing smoke-test token below.

session token of fahap-hawip = htk31_7852f2b3276dba2738f98fa97f92237

## Step 3: Migrate canary gating rules

Move gating rules from the legacy Pellcourt evaluator to Gatekeep v2. Old rules are ignored after this step. Export them first; the formats are not compatible. Gatekeep v2 evaluates error-rate and latency windows per slice and halts promotion automatically — no manual override during the soak period. Verify the rollback webhook fires in staging before touching prod. Keep the legacy evaluator running read-only for one release cycle. Start the v2 evaluator with the configuration values below.

config for bawep-faduf:
OLIATH_HOST=oliath.qorvellabs.internal
OLIATH_PORT=9000

## Env Vars: Dockhopper Rebalancer

Welcome aboard! Dockhopper is our little tool that decides which vans move bikes between stations overnight in Gullport. Most behavior lives in env vars: `REBALANCE_WINDOW` sets the run hours, `MAX_VAN_LOAD` caps bikes per trip, and `DRY_RUN=true` is your friend for the first week. Copy `.env.sample`, tweak locally, never commit your real file. The optimizer calls the Tidemark routing service on every run, and that call is authenticated with the value set on the line below.

env line for kajep-bahip: LEDGER_TOKEN29=99b839f98891c2049d3cfc2138cb5